To the release manager: I'm passing ownership of the Pellwick deep-link router to Sorrel before the 4.2 cut. The intent-matching table now lives in the Farrowgate config service; stale entries were purged last sprint. Watch the fallback route — it silently swallows malformed slugs, which inflated our drop-off metrics in March. The staging resolver needs its keystore unlocked before each regression pass, and that keystore accepts only one credential. For the signing vault, the recovery phrase is noted directly below.

recovery phrase for tafog-fafog: novix-novdor-fraath-brieth-olieth-oliix-rusix-wenion-julax-druox

Scope: maintainer accounts for the Emberline device-firmware update channel only.

1. Confirm account lockout in the channel admin log; note last successful publish.
2. Freeze the stable ring before touching credentials — devices must not pull unsigned manifests.
3. Revoke the old signing session; do not rotate the channel key unless compromise is confirmed.
4. Restore access from the escrow bundle. Unfreezing the ring afterward requires a second maintainer's ack.
5. Unsealing the escrow bundle requires the recovery passphrase:

unlock words, hahip-baduf: holwyn-istath-julvan

Ticket: Staging env misconfigured for Siftgate bloom filter

The bloom layer in front of the Pellet KV store is rejecting all lookups in staging because the env file was copied from the dev template without credentials. False-positive tuning values are fine; only the auth line is missing. To unblock the weekly demo, the Pellet admission secret must be set on the following line.

env line for yaguf-fajop: LEDGER_TOKEN13=fb08984397349

Archiving cold storage buckets (Halewood platform): buckets flagged inactive for 180 days are candidates for archive. Before archiving, confirm the owning team has acknowledged the notice ticket and that no retention hold is attached. Run the archive job during the weekend window only; it compresses and moves objects to glacier-tier, after which restores take up to 48 hours. If a customer requests a restore, open a support ticket with priority set by their plan tier. The step-by-step archive and restore procedure is documented here.

runbook for taduf-kawef: https://confluence.qorvelsys.internal/projects/display/display/pages